How much do weekend np j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 19, 2026, the average yearly pay for weekend np in Delaware is $130,407.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$108,100.00 and $150,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Weekend Nurse Practitioners?

Weekend Nurse Practitioners (NPs) are advanced practice registered nurses who primarily work on weekends to provide medical care and services. They assess, diagnose, and treat patients, often in hospitals, urgent care centers, or clinics during weekend shifts. Their responsibilities may include performing physical exams, ordering and interpreting tests, prescribing medications, and collaborating with physicians and other healthcare professionals. Weekend NPs help ensure that patients receive continuous, high-quality care outside of regular weekday hours. This role is essential for maintaining adequate healthcare coverage and supporting patient needs during weekends.

What are some common challenges faced by Weekend Nurse Practitioners, and how can they be addressed?

Weekend Nurse Practitioners often manage higher patient volumes and acute cases due to limited staff and resources during weekends. This can require quick decision-making and strong prioritization skills. Collaboration with on-call physicians, utilizing telemedicine support, and clear communication with weekday teams are essential to ensure continuity of care. Proactively organizing patient information and maintaining detailed documentation can also help address these challenges and improve patient outcomes.
